[Federal Register: August 11, 1998 (Volume 63, Number 154)] [Notices] [Page 42868-42869] From the Federal Register Online via GPO Access [wais.access.gpo.gov] [DOCID:fr11au98-119] ----------------------------------------------------------------------- DEPARTMENT OF THE INTERIOR Bureau of Land Management [AK-962-1410-00-P; AA-6678-A] Notice for Publication; Alaska Native Claims Selection In accordance with Departmental regulation 43 CFR 2650.7(d), notice is hereby given that a decision to issue conveyance under the provisions of Sec. 14(a) of the Alaska Native Claims Settlement Act of December 18, 1971, 43 U.S.C. 1601, 1613(a), will be issued to Levelock Natives, Limited for 174.58 acres. The land involved is in the vicinity of Levelock, Alaska, and is described as Tract B, U.S. Survey No. 4877, Alaska, located within T. 12 S., R. 45 W., Seward Meridian. A notice of the decision will be published once a week, for four (4) consecutive weeks, in the Bristol Bay Times. Copies of the decision may be obtained by contacting the Alaska State Office of the Bureau of Land Management, 222 West Seventh Avenue, #13, Anchorage, Alaska 99513- 7599 ((907) 271-5960). Any party claiming a property interest which is adversely affected by the decision, an agency of the Federal government or regional corporation, shall have until September 10, 1998, to file an appeal. However, parties [[Page 42869]] receiving service by certified mail shall have 30 days from the date of receipt to file an appeal. Appeals must be filed in the Bureau of Land Management at the address identified above, where the requirements for filing an appeal may be obtained. Parties who do not file an appeal in accordance with the requirements of 43 CFR Part 4, Subpart E, shall be deemed to have waived their rights. Katherine L.
